What is a PMO project manager?

A PMO manager coordinates the operation of a PMO, or a product management office. Job duties include overseeing the office, which provides technical support and helps an organization develop a strategy for completing IT projects. They ensure that all work is done quickly and according to best business practices as well as internal company policies. Career qualifications of a PMO manager often include post-secondary education in business administration or a subject related to the specific field you want to work in, and work exper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a PMO project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a PMO Project Manager, you need expertise in project management methodologies, strong organizational skills, and usually a degree in business or a related field, often supported by PMP or PRINCE2 certification. Familiarity with project management software like Microsoft Project, JIRA, or Smartsheet is crucial for tracking progress and managing resources. Exceptional leadership, communication, and stakeholder management abilities help drive project teams and align objectives. These skills and qualities are essential to ensure projects are delivered on time, within scope, and aligned with organizational strategy.

How does a PMO project manager typically balance multiple projects and competing priorities within the portfolio?

A PMO Project Manager is often responsible for overseeing several projects simultaneously, each with its own deadlines and resource requirements. Balancing these priorities involves using standardized project management frameworks and tools to track progress, allocate resources efficiently, and identify risks early. Regular communication with project teams and stakeholders is key to ensuring alignment and addressing any bottlenecks quickly. Additionally, PMO Project Managers often facilitate portfolio reviews and status meetings to adjust priorities as business needs evolve.

What is the difference between Pmo Project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ectPmo Project ManagerProject Coordinator
CertificationsPMP, PgMP, PMI-ACPCAPM, PMP (optional)
Work EnvironmentStrategic planning, overseeing multiple projects, stakeholder communicationSupporting project teams, scheduling, documentation
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in organizations with formal project management offices, across industriesCommon in project teams, assisting project managers in various industries

The Pmo Project Manager focuses on strategic oversight, managing multiple projects, and aligning them with organizational goals. In contrast, a Project Coordinator provides support to project teams by handling scheduling, documentation, and communication tasks. While both roles require project management knowledge, the Pmo Project Manager typically has more advanced certifications and responsibilities related to project governance and strategic planning.

Can a Pmo Project Manager become a project manager?

A PMO Project Manager can transition to a project manager role, especially if they develop skills in direct project execution, stakeholder management, and obtain relevant certifications like PMP. Experience in managing projects within the PMO provides a strong foundation for moving into standalone project management positions.
